10 children injured in tragic school van accident

MANDI BAHAUDDIN: In a tragic incident, ten children were injured in a school van accident near the village of Churand in Mandi Bahauddin on Monday morning.

According to Rescue 1122, a loader vehicle reportedly collided with a school van near the village of Churand in Mandi Bahauddin on Monday morning.
Rescue teams quickly arrived and took all injured children to the nearest hospital. Rescue officials said most children are stable, but a couple of children have sustained serious injuries.
Authorities are investigating the cause of the accident. whereas the drivers are advised to follow traffic guidelines to avoid such incidents.
Pakistan has witnessed a surge in traffic accidents in the past few weeks, causing deaths of several people, especially in Karachi, where multiple motorcyclist lost their lives in horrific accidents.
